gigi

Membres
  • Compteur de contenus

    644
  • Inscription

  • Dernière visite

À propos de gigi

  • Rang
    400

Profil général

  • Genre
    Homme
  • Lieu
    France

Profil FileMaker

  • FM Conférence
  • FM
    FMP11A, 12A, 14A, 16A
  • OS
    Windows 10, Mac OS
  • Certification
  • FBA
    --Non membre--
    Membre
    Platinum
    Trainer
    Reseller
  1. Trop fort, c'est exactement ça !!!! Un grand merci. Gigi
  2. Merci Clem, Malheureusement ça ne fonctionne pas : voir cette vidéo
  3. Bonjour, J'essaie d'utiliser cette nouvelle fonction de FM16 sur les données JSON (en bleu ci-dessous). Mon but est d'extraire les valeurs de "lat" et "lng" au niveau de "formatted_address". Malheureusement, en dehors de l'objet "results." utilisé en second paramètre, aucun résultat avec cette fonction. Par exemple : JSONGetElement ( Ma_rubrique_contenant_les_donnees ; "formatted_address.geometry.location.lat.") me renvoie du vide... Ou est-ce que ça cloche ? Merci pour votre aide. Gigi { "results" : [ { "address_components" : [ { "long_name" : "55", "short_name" : "55", "types" : [ "street_number" ] }, { "long_name" : "Rue du Faubourg Saint-Honoré", "short_name" : "Rue du Faubourg Saint-Honoré", "types" : [ "route" ] }, { "long_name" : "Paris", "short_name" : "Paris", "types" : [ "locality", "political" ] }, { "long_name" : "Paris", "short_name" : "Paris", "types" : [ "administrative_area_level_2", "political" ] }, { "long_name" : "Île-de-France", "short_name" : "Île-de-France", "types" : [ "administrative_area_level_1", "political" ] }, { "long_name" : "France", "short_name" : "FR", "types" : [ "country", "political" ] }, { "long_name" : "75008", "short_name" : "75008", "types" : [ "postal_code" ] } ], "formatted_address" : "55 Rue du Faubourg Saint-Honoré, 75008 Paris, France", "geometry" : { "location" : { "lat" : 48.87060109999999, "lng" : 2.3169533 }, "location_type" : "ROOFTOP", "viewport" : { "northeast" : { "lat" : 48.8719500802915, "lng" : 2.318302280291502 }, "southwest" : { "lat" : 48.8692521197085, "lng" : 2.315604319708498 } } }, "partial_match" : true, "place_id" : "ChIJjz4lmM5v5kcRy8CEVPWnr8s", "types" : [ "street_address" ] } ], "status" : "OK" }
  4. Bizarre en effet. L'essentiel est que tu sois parvenu(e) à tes fins ;-)
  5. Si ton fichier n'est pas classé secret défense, ça vaudrait le coup de le poster ici (en tout cas un morceau) afin qu'on y jette un oeil et te dise si le comportement est le même sur nos configurations...
  6. Rubrique liée = rubriques appartenant à une autre table que celle du modèle, dont l'affichage est permis par un lien entre les deux tables.
  7. Bonjour, Les rubriques dans lesquelles tu effectues la recherche sont-elles des rubriques liées ?
  8. Je viens de prendre 20 minutes pour regarder. Pas encore tout compris mais c'est intéressant. Merci à toi !
  9. Bonjour, J'ai deux tables. L'une contenant uniquement une rubrique globale nommée "selection" et l'autre contenant une liste du personnel. Un lien d'égalité entre deux rubriques est établi entre les deux Je souhaiterais, lors de l'entrée dans un menu (quel que soit son emplacement), déclencher un script qui par une requête SQL définit la rubrique globale "selection" de façon à filtrer les données affichées dans le menu. Problème : le déclencheur de script lors de l'entrée dans un menu ne s'active qu'après l'évènement d'ouverture du menu donc ma liste s'actualise avec un coup de retard... Si j'essaie de contourner le problème en définissant ma rubrique menu comme étant un bouton et que j'exécute le script de mise à jour de "selection" en cliquant sur le bouton, je n'arrive pas à obtenir le déroulement du menu avec un "aller à l'objet" (d'après la documentation, on ne peut apparemment dérouler un menu qu'en cliquant dessus avec la souris). Me voici donc bloqué et ayant besoin d'aide...
  10. Re-bonjour Jerem, Venant de Windows (j'utilise Filemaker sur Mac depuis peu), j'ai appris à utiliser "Nouvelle fenêtre" le moins souvent possible car cette action a une répercussion assez pénible à gérer sur toute fenêtre active "agrandie". Si tu souhaites utiliser ta solution sur Mac ET PC, c'est vraiment une chose à considérer. En dehors de ça, garder toujours la même fenêtre, c'est aussi s'exposer à des modèles parfois pauvres en contenu qui s'affichent plein écran comme un cheveu sur la soupe... Sinon, c'est effectivement tel que tu conclus
  11. Jerem, dans ton script je ne vois pas d'instruction pour aller à l'objet TE dont tu veux activer la rangée. Du coup, ton script va activer la première TE de ton modèle qui figure vraisemblablement sur ton premier onglet.
  12. Bonjour, Il faut vraisemblablement que tu nommes également tes différentes TE et utilises "Aller à l'objet" TE de ton choix avant d'en activer la rangée externe.
  13. Bonjour, Pourquoi pas une rubrique "nombre_ventes" au niveau de ta table produits qui, à chaque incorporation du produit dans une ligne_ventes incrémenterait de 1 le contenu de la rubrique ? Ceci suppose aussi de décrémenter si la ligne-ventes est supprimée. Si la base est déjà fonctionnelle, un script de mise à jour utilisant une liaison table_produits / lignes_ventes (IDproduit=IDproduit) et la fonction decompte permettra d'alimenter la rubrique en question.
  14. Entretien.fmp12 Bonjour, L'intervalle peut évidemment être modulé par variable. Voici un second fichier pour te donner des idées... Le bouton "Nouvel entretien" s'utilise lors du premier entretien de chaque bac. Ensuite c'est le fait de cocher la case de réalisation du nouvel entretien qui crée un nouvel enregistrement dans la table Entretien. Pour ce qui est de la recherche des entretiens à effectuer, elle s'effectue sur TOUS les enregistrements qui sont en entretien dépassé et ceux à venir (dans une amplitude réglable par l'utilisateur). Tout ceci n'est fait à la "va-vite" que pour te donner des idées. Entretien.fmp12